    Description

    The Department of Defense, specifically the Defense Logistics Agency, is seeking to procure a motion transducer. A motion transducer is typically used to convert motion or movement into an electrical signal. The procurement is for a quantity of 40 units, and the delivery is required within 85 days. The transducer will be delivered to DLA Distribution. The solicitation is an RFQ (Request for Quote) and can be accessed through the provided link. Hard copies of the solicitation are not available, and specifications, plans, or drawings are also not provided. All responsible sources are invited to submit a quote electronically.
